Consider the graph of the quadratic function y = 3x2 – 3x – 6. What are the solutions of the quadratic equation 0 = 3x2 − 3x − 6?
a. –1 and 20
b. –6 and –1
c. –1 and 1
d. –6 and 2

roots of the equation 3x² -3x-6=0 are
-1 and 2,
all choices are given wrong
3*2²-3*2-6=0
12-6-6=0
0=0, which is true , so root is 2
3*20²-3*20-6=0
600-60-6=0
534=0
which is wrong, so root is 2, but not 20
